$5 Billion Refinery Upgrade Plan Faces Policy Uncertainty Over Govt’s Deregulation Push

The Pakistani government's push to deregulate petroleum prices has put the country's refinery sector at a policy crossroads, creating uncertainty over billions of dollars in planned refinery investments. Industry experts are calling for a clear choice between allowing market forces to determine refinery economics and maintaining the existing system of deemed duties, incentives, escrow accounts, and administrative controls.

The government's proposed 2.5-percentage-point reduction in the deemed duty on High-Speed Diesel, along with the financial impact on refineries, has further complicated the situation. Refineries argue that the retrospective application of the reduction is penalizing them, while the government insists on its implementation. The situation has become particularly urgent as the government seeks to finalize long-delayed Brownfield Refinery Policy agreements while also considering greater deregulation of petroleum-product prices.
